:root{--ng-bg:#fff;--ng-text:#0f172a;--ng-muted:#6b7280;--ng-border:#e5e7eb;--ng-hover:#f3f4f6;--ng-active:#e5e7eb;--ng-shadow:0 10px 15px rgba(0,0,0,.05)}.ng-sr-only{height:1px;margin:-1px;overflow:hidden;padding:0;position:absolute;width:1px;clip:rect(0,0,0,0);border:0;white-space:nowrap}.ng-header{background:var(--ng-bg);border-bottom:1px solid var(--ng-border);inset:0 0 auto 0;position:fixed;z-index:50}.ng-container{margin:0 auto;max-width:1280px;padding:0 10px 0 94px;position:relative}.ng-row{gap:16px;height:64px}.ng-left,.ng-row{align-items:center;display:flex}.ng-left{flex:1 1 auto;gap:12px}.ng-brand{align-items:flex-start;color:inherit;display:inline-flex;gap:12px;text-decoration:none}.ng-brand img{height:103px;left:10px;position:absolute;top:0;width:auto}.ng-nav{align-items:center;display:none;gap:4px;margin-left:8px}.ng-btn,.ng-link{align-items:center;appearance:none;background:transparent;border:1px solid transparent;border-radius:999px;color:inherit;cursor:pointer;display:inline-flex;font-family:Inter,arial,sans-serif;font-size:inherit;font-weight:500;gap:8px;height:44px;padding:0 16px;text-decoration:none;white-space:nowrap}.ng-btn:hover,.ng-link:hover{background:var(--ng-hover);text-decoration:none}.ng-btn:active,.ng-link:active{background:var(--ng-active);text-decoration:none}.ng-login-btn{align-items:center;background:#fff;border:1px solid var(--ng-border);border-radius:999px;cursor:pointer;display:inline-flex;font-weight:500;gap:8px;height:44px;margin-left:auto;padding:0 16px;text-decoration:none}.ng-login-btn:hover{background:var(--ng-hover);text-decoration:none}.ng-dropdown{position:relative}.ng-dropdown-panel{background:#fff;border:1px solid var(--ng-border);border-radius:12px;box-shadow:var(--ng-shadow);left:0;min-width:220px;opacity:0;padding:8px;pointer-events:none;position:absolute;top:calc(100% + 8px);transform:translateY(-6px);transition:transform .22s ease,opacity .22s ease}.ng-dropdown-item{align-items:center;border-radius:10px;color:inherit;display:flex;font-weight:500;padding:10px 12px;text-decoration:none}.ng-dropdown-item:hover{background:var(--ng-hover);text-decoration:none}.ng-dropdown[aria-expanded=true] .ng-dropdown-panel{opacity:1;pointer-events:auto;transform:translateY(0)}.ng-icon{display:inline-block;height:24px;width:24px}.ng-hamburger{align-items:center;background:transparent;border:1px solid transparent;border-radius:999px;cursor:pointer;display:none;height:44px;justify-content:center;position:relative;width:44px;z-index:70}.ng-hamburger:hover{background:var(--ng-hover)}.ng-icon-wrap{height:24px;position:relative;width:24px}.icon-menu{display:block}.icon-close,.ng-hamburger.is-open .icon-menu{display:none}.ng-hamburger.is-open .icon-close{display:block}.ng-mobile-overlay{background:rgba(0,0,0,.35);bottom:0;left:0;opacity:0;pointer-events:none;position:fixed;right:0;top:64px;transition:opacity .2s ease,visibility 0s linear .2s;visibility:hidden;z-index:60}.ng-mobile-overlay[data-open=true]{opacity:1;transition:opacity .2s ease;visibility:visible}.ng-mobile-drawer{background:#fff;border-left:1px solid var(--ng-border);bottom:0;display:flex;flex-direction:column;pointer-events:auto;position:fixed;right:0;top:64px;transform:translateX(100%);transition:transform .3s ease;width:100vw;will-change:transform;z-index:61}.ng-mobile-drawer.is-open{transform:translateX(0)}.ng-drawer-footer{border-top:none;margin-top:20px;order:0;padding:16px 16px 16px 25px}.ng-drawer-login{align-items:center;background:#fff;border:1px solid var(--ng-border);border-radius:999px;cursor:pointer;display:inline-flex;font-family:Inter,Arial,sans-serif;font-weight:500;gap:8px;height:44px;justify-content:center;width:100%}.ng-drawer-login:hover{background:var(--ng-hover)}.ng-drawer-nav{order:1;padding:0 16px 16px}.ng-drawer-link{border-radius:10px;color:inherit;display:block;font-weight:700;padding:16px 12px;text-decoration:none}.ng-drawer-link:hover{background:var(--ng-hover);text-decoration:none}@media (min-width:769px){.ng-nav{display:inline-flex}.ng-hamburger{display:none}.ng-mobile-overlay{opacity:0!important;visibility:hidden!important}}@media (max-width:768px){.ng-container{padding:0 10px}.ng-hamburger{display:inline-flex}.ng-login-btn{display:none}.ng-brand img{height:64px;position:inherit}}